Sketchbook Project: Winter Ball

Last night I went to a Winter Masquerade Ball with some friends, to raise money for charity. The event is called Stomp, and held a few times a year with a different theme each time. It's put on by the different dance schools around Canberra, who also provide some entertainment in the form of VERY impressive demonstrations throughout the night.

So...we made some masks, got dressed up and went along to dance the night away. And the night wouldn't have been complete if I hadn't added a Sketchbook Project entry about it!
I had some interesting issues because after laying down three layers of Gesso you could still see the ink from the previous page, so I put down some white acrylic paint...but of course my coloured pencils didn't work very well over the top! You can't see very well in the scan but the snow and snowflakes are all glittery.
